Pioneer install in 2007+Camry

heyall .. i jus cop'd the Pioneer 3200bt.. I have the 07 Camry w/ the JBL stock system. It has built in BT. I know id probably find out on my own first but i decided to ask here prior to me taking apart my dash console. Does the bt that is stock have the same plug as the one thats on the back of the 3200bt?

I want to keep the stock placements of the mic for the bluetooth and im wondering if its as simple as plugging in teh stock bt system into the HU instead of having to install & re locate the mic that is supplied with the HU.

when you upgrade to a aftermarket radio you will loose the stock bluetooth. also keep in mind since you have a jbl system you will need an adapter to work with the stock jbl system which costs an additional $60-80.
